For those of you flashaholics out there, I will list everything I have in my setup and maybe some of you can achieve similar results (i have flashed and used every Rom from jmz odex stock, midnight sense/senseless, mobsters both hd/lite, mobsters wildcard, harmonia, negalite blurom) and now here's where I ended up. And I never applied the OTA update. Special shout out and thanks to Ramjet! His instructions and various feedback and assistance on here and xda are soooo simple to follow-- You are a godsend! Big thsnk you to jmz for his awesome kernel! Huge thanks to Lakersdroid for his build.prop! cocheese101 for MMS fix
No, I am NOT S-Off I'm not "stupid" LOL I just learn by making mistakes and do things my own way which may be redundant to some of you but anyway, I am on Hboot 1.57 S-On and just decided to rewind and go forward here you are:
1.) Flashed SetMainLowVersion found here
http://forum.xda-developers.com/showpost.php?p=34239031&postcount=130
2.) Relocked bootloader/Ran VM RUU found here
http://androidforums.com/evo-v-4g-all-things-root/642504-ruu-stock-ruu-unroot-virgin-mobile-3d.html
3.) RUU Completed, I applied the OTA and all other updates then I went back and reflashed my unlock code.bin file and flashed TWRP, continued and installed 4EXT Recovery (this is a must have for those who are S-On)
here 4EXT Development
4.) Decided to try Viper3d latest build r330, after basic setup, I replaced the build.prop with a fixed build.prop and now Opera Mobile, Chrome Beta, everything now works for me.
http://beta.androidfilehost.com/?a=show&w=files&flid=626
The working build.prop is here, thanks LakersDroid!
http://androidforums.com/5492915-post95.html
Simply copy/paste over the current build.prop in System, fix permissions, rebooted into 4ext wipe dalvik and cache.
5.) MMS works as well thanks to cocheese101!
here http://androidforums.com/5489708-post90.html
Simply replace former EPST in System/app and you don't need to fix permissions just reboot then ##3282# and edit mode then enter your MSL if you are this far you should have it by now! Enter in MSL when prompted for it then go to Advanced, MMSC and replace current sprint MMSC with http://mmsc.vmobl.com:8088/mms?
Your MMS will now work.
Now onto my final setup-- I decided not to use anthrax kernel or ziggys kernel instead I flashed JMZ's kernel (very stable) found here
Goo.im Downloads - Browsing Kernel
I am running STABLE with no issues boot loops no freezes at a staggering 1.9ghz and both cores running Smartassv2! I am on stock PRL 61009 I have never changed the prl it's pointless when I'm getting consistent 120-150kb a SECOND DL speeds w/ OTA, ViperRom, and data tweaks. I'm currently browsing and downloading playstore apps faster than ever before! YouTube videos load quickly in HQ/HD.
After everything was setup, I added this to the build.prop then wiped dalvik/cache in 4ext
# Moar Tweekz
net.tcp.buffersize.default=4096,87380,256960,4096,16384,256960
net.tcp.buffersize.wifi=4096,87380,256960,4096,16384,256960
net.tcp.buffersize.umts=4096,87380,256960,4096,16384,256960
net.tcp.buffersize.gprs=4096,87380,256960,4096,16384,256960
net.tcp.buffersize.edge=4096,87380,256960,4096,16384,256960
net.tcp.buffersize.wimax=4096,221184,524288,4096,16384,110208
media.stagefright.enable-player=true
media.stagefright.enable-meta=true
media.stagefright.enable-scan=true
media.stagefright.enable-http=true
media.stagefright.enable-record=false
ro.ril.hsxpa=3
ro.ril.gprsclass=32
ro.ril.hep=1
ro.ril.hsdpa.category=28
ro.ril.enable.3g.prefix=1
ro.ril.htcmaskw1.bitmask=4294967295
ro.ril.htcmaskw1=268449905
ro.ril.hsupa.category=9
ro.ril.def.agps.mode=2
ro.ril.def.agps.feature=1
ro.ril.enable.sdr=1
ro.ril.enable.gea3=1
ro.ril.enable.fd.plmn.prefix=23402,23410,23411 ro.ril.enable.a52=0
ro.ril.enable.a53=1
ro.ril.enable.dtm=1
persist.cust.tel.eons=1
ro.cdma.nbpcd=1
ro.ril.enable.amr.wideband=1
net.ipv4.tcp_ecn=0
net.ipv4.route.flush=1
net.ipv4.tcp_rfc1337=1
net.ipv4.ip_no_pmtu_disc=0
net.ipv4.tcp_sack=1
net.ipv4.tcp_fack=1
net.ipv4.tcp_window_scaling=1
net.ipv4.tcp_timestamps=1
net.ipv4.tcp_rmem=4096 39000 187000
net.ipv4.tcp_wmem=4096 39000 187000
net.ipv4.tcp_mem=187000 187000 187000
net.ipv4.tcp_no_metrics_save=1
net.ipv4.tcp_moderate_rcvbuf=1
ro.telephony.call_ring.multiple=false
ro.telephony.ril.v3=icccardstatus,skipbrokendatacall,datacall,signalstrength,facilitylock
Finally, after this, I closed it out by editing info in EPST ##3282# or ##data# if you will
Under data profile primary and secondary home agent should be zeroed out, then under EVDO "CDMA HDR Only", under advanced Slot Cycle Index 2, go down to RTSP/HTTP SETTING, the IP fields should be 0.0.0.0 and both ports need to be 0. One less proxy/VM Sprint loophole to worry about! Commit changes, reboot and enjoy!
I have NEVER hit download speeds this fast through Sprint or VM and this is coming from a former Triumph owner. I am consistently between 70 KB/sec to 150 KB/sec!
Hope some of you achieve similar results!
No, I am NOT S-Off I'm not "stupid" LOL I just learn by making mistakes and do things my own way which may be redundant to some of you but anyway, I am on Hboot 1.57 S-On and just decided to rewind and go forward here you are:
1.) Flashed SetMainLowVersion found here
http://forum.xda-developers.com/showpost.php?p=34239031&postcount=130
2.) Relocked bootloader/Ran VM RUU found here
http://androidforums.com/evo-v-4g-all-things-root/642504-ruu-stock-ruu-unroot-virgin-mobile-3d.html
3.) RUU Completed, I applied the OTA and all other updates then I went back and reflashed my unlock code.bin file and flashed TWRP, continued and installed 4EXT Recovery (this is a must have for those who are S-On)
here 4EXT Development
4.) Decided to try Viper3d latest build r330, after basic setup, I replaced the build.prop with a fixed build.prop and now Opera Mobile, Chrome Beta, everything now works for me.
http://beta.androidfilehost.com/?a=show&w=files&flid=626
The working build.prop is here, thanks LakersDroid!
http://androidforums.com/5492915-post95.html
Simply copy/paste over the current build.prop in System, fix permissions, rebooted into 4ext wipe dalvik and cache.
5.) MMS works as well thanks to cocheese101!
here http://androidforums.com/5489708-post90.html
Simply replace former EPST in System/app and you don't need to fix permissions just reboot then ##3282# and edit mode then enter your MSL if you are this far you should have it by now! Enter in MSL when prompted for it then go to Advanced, MMSC and replace current sprint MMSC with http://mmsc.vmobl.com:8088/mms?
Your MMS will now work.
Now onto my final setup-- I decided not to use anthrax kernel or ziggys kernel instead I flashed JMZ's kernel (very stable) found here
Goo.im Downloads - Browsing Kernel
I am running STABLE with no issues boot loops no freezes at a staggering 1.9ghz and both cores running Smartassv2! I am on stock PRL 61009 I have never changed the prl it's pointless when I'm getting consistent 120-150kb a SECOND DL speeds w/ OTA, ViperRom, and data tweaks. I'm currently browsing and downloading playstore apps faster than ever before! YouTube videos load quickly in HQ/HD.
After everything was setup, I added this to the build.prop then wiped dalvik/cache in 4ext
# Moar Tweekz
net.tcp.buffersize.default=4096,87380,256960,4096,16384,256960
net.tcp.buffersize.wifi=4096,87380,256960,4096,16384,256960
net.tcp.buffersize.umts=4096,87380,256960,4096,16384,256960
net.tcp.buffersize.gprs=4096,87380,256960,4096,16384,256960
net.tcp.buffersize.edge=4096,87380,256960,4096,16384,256960
net.tcp.buffersize.wimax=4096,221184,524288,4096,16384,110208
media.stagefright.enable-player=true
media.stagefright.enable-meta=true
media.stagefright.enable-scan=true
media.stagefright.enable-http=true
media.stagefright.enable-record=false
ro.ril.hsxpa=3
ro.ril.gprsclass=32
ro.ril.hep=1
ro.ril.hsdpa.category=28
ro.ril.enable.3g.prefix=1
ro.ril.htcmaskw1.bitmask=4294967295
ro.ril.htcmaskw1=268449905
ro.ril.hsupa.category=9
ro.ril.def.agps.mode=2
ro.ril.def.agps.feature=1
ro.ril.enable.sdr=1
ro.ril.enable.gea3=1
ro.ril.enable.fd.plmn.prefix=23402,23410,23411 ro.ril.enable.a52=0
ro.ril.enable.a53=1
ro.ril.enable.dtm=1
persist.cust.tel.eons=1
ro.cdma.nbpcd=1
ro.ril.enable.amr.wideband=1
net.ipv4.tcp_ecn=0
net.ipv4.route.flush=1
net.ipv4.tcp_rfc1337=1
net.ipv4.ip_no_pmtu_disc=0
net.ipv4.tcp_sack=1
net.ipv4.tcp_fack=1
net.ipv4.tcp_window_scaling=1
net.ipv4.tcp_timestamps=1
net.ipv4.tcp_rmem=4096 39000 187000
net.ipv4.tcp_wmem=4096 39000 187000
net.ipv4.tcp_mem=187000 187000 187000
net.ipv4.tcp_no_metrics_save=1
net.ipv4.tcp_moderate_rcvbuf=1
ro.telephony.call_ring.multiple=false
ro.telephony.ril.v3=icccardstatus,skipbrokendatacall,datacall,signalstrength,facilitylock
Finally, after this, I closed it out by editing info in EPST ##3282# or ##data# if you will
Under data profile primary and secondary home agent should be zeroed out, then under EVDO "CDMA HDR Only", under advanced Slot Cycle Index 2, go down to RTSP/HTTP SETTING, the IP fields should be 0.0.0.0 and both ports need to be 0. One less proxy/VM Sprint loophole to worry about! Commit changes, reboot and enjoy!
I have NEVER hit download speeds this fast through Sprint or VM and this is coming from a former Triumph owner. I am consistently between 70 KB/sec to 150 KB/sec!
Hope some of you achieve similar results!
